系統架構設計師-作業系統

 

前言:

  之前文章釋出後,發現還是有一定閱讀量的,所以決定繼續發一些思維導圖。

  思維導圖首先以思維結構為主,其次以考試的內容進行一定的改動(如本次,將“嵌入系統”放在了“作業系統(功能)“分類中)。

  另外,如果感覺圖片模糊的話,估計是你頁面展示問題,可以單獨將該圖片放大(這個頁面的圖片可是5375x7211的)。

  

 

一,XMIND:

 

 

二,補充:

  無論從何種角度來說,作業系統的瞭解都有其必要性。就好像資訊學院的學生都會學微控制器,彙編等。這對程式設計師瞭解底層,擴充套件瞭解面都有好處。先從考試來說,作業系統也是必考內容,每年都會考PV操作(必考),嵌入式作業系統(必考,案例必考一題,但是不推薦非擅長此問題的人去為了應試而去學。因為內容挺多,聽複雜的,記憶的東西也不少)等。而從實踐來說,作業系統中很多知識經常對一部分專業的人有價值,如檔案管理,儲存管理等。對於佔比最多的通用程式設計師,PV操作是無論如何都避免不了的(其實,個人認為程式設計師越到後面,往往對知識面的廣度有著越高的要求。很多方面都有著相通的原理)。因為,程式設計師必然需要與同步非同步問題,阻塞與非阻塞問題打交道。